1. Warm up engine.
2. Turn ignition switch OFF.
3. Using CONSULT-II, make sure no error codes are indicated for
self-diagnosis items. Refer to EC section, ªFuel Pressure
Releaseº.
IDo not disconnect CONSULT-II until the end of this operation;
it will be used to check engine rpm and for error detection at
the end of this operation.
4. Disconnect the negative battery terminal.
5. Remove the following parts.
IIntercooler
IThrottle body
IRocker cover
6. To prevent fuel from being injected during inspection, remove
fuel injection pump fuse [ENG CONT A/T (15A)] from fuse box
on the right side of engine compartment.
7. Remove glow plugs from all the cylinders.
IBefore removal, clean the surrounding area to prevent
entry of any foreign materials into the engine.
ICarefully remove glow plugs to prevent any damage or
breakage.
IHandle with care to avoid applying any shock to glow
plugs.
8. Install adapter (SST) to installation holes of glow plugs and
connect compression gauge for diesel engine.
:15-19N×m (1.5 - 2.0 kg-m, 11 - 14 ft-lb)
9. Connect battery negative terminal.
10. Set the ignition switch to ªSTARTº and crank. When gauge
pointer stabilizes, read compression pressure and engine rpm.
Repeat the above steps for each cylinder.
IAlways use a fully-charged battery to obtain specified
engine speed.
Unit: kPa (bar, kg/cm2, psi)/rpm
Standard MinimumDifference limit between
cylinders
2,942 (29.42, 30.0, 427)/
2002,452 (24.52, 25.0, 356)/
200294 (2.94, 3.0, 43)/200
IWhen engine rpm is out of the specified range, check the spe-
cific gravity of battery liquid. Measure again under corrected
conditions.
IIf engine rpm exceeds the limit, check valve clearance and
combustion chamber components (valves, valve seats, cylinder
head gaskets, piston rings, pistons, cylinder bores, cylinder
block upper and lower surfaces) and measure again.
11. Complete this operation as follows:
a. Turn the ignition switch to ªOFFº.
b. Disconnect battery negative terminal.
c. Replace glow plug oil seals and install glow plugs.
d. Install fuel injection pump fuse [ENG CONT A/T (15A)].
e. Connect battery negative terminal.
f. Using CONSULT-II make sure no error code is indicated for
items of self-diagnosis. Refer to EC section, ªTrouble Diagno-
sis Ð Indexº.

General Specifications
Cylinder arrangementIn-line 4
Displacementcm
3(cu in) 2,953 (180.19)
Bore and strokemm (in) 96 x 102 (3.78 x 4.02)
Valve arrangementDOHC
Firing order1-3-4-2
Number of piston ringsCompression 2
Oil1
Number of main bearings5
Compression ratio17.9
Compression Pressure
Unit: kPa (bar, kg/cm2, psi)/200 rpm
Compression pressureStandard 2,942 (29.42, 30.0, 427)
Minimum 2,452 (24.52, 25.0, 356)
Differential limit between cylinders 294 (2.94, 3.0, 43)
Cylinder Head
Unit: mm (in)
Standard Limit
Head surface distortion Less than 0.05 (0.0020) 0.2 (0.008)
